Abstract

The utility model provides an auxiliary device of a grinding and polishing machine, which comprises a polishing machine and a supporting plate, wherein a polishing disc is arranged in the polishing machine, a plurality of clamps are arranged above the polishing disc, grinding sample pieces are arranged in the clamps, and guide rods are connected outside the clamps and fixed on the periphery of a connecting rod. The supporting plate is connected with a support, the support can stretch out and draw back along a vertical direction, the top end of the support is connected with a supporting rod, the supporting rod can stretch out and draw back along a transverse direction, one end of the supporting rod is connected with a supporting sleeve, the supporting sleeve is sleeved outside the connecting rod, and the supporting sleeve fixes the connecting rod through a locking screw. Description

Auxiliary device of grinding and polishing machine
Technical Field
The utility model belongs to the technical field of auxiliary equipment of polishing machines, and particularly relates to an auxiliary device of a grinding and polishing machine.
Background
The grinding and polishing machine is an instrument used in the field of mechanical engineering, can treat the surface of a mechanical product, can rub a grinding wheel or a polishing wheel with the surface of a workpiece, and can grind and polish the workpiece to improve the surface roughness of the workpiece. Some grinding and polishing machines have no auxiliary device, and only can be operated in a single way when grinding and polishing sample pieces; if the grinding sample piece is not held flatly by a hand, the phenomenon that the grinding sample piece flies out instantly is easily caused, and operators are easily injured in the flying-out process; the work efficiency is low and dangerous.

Detailed Description
As shown in fig. 1, 2, 3, 4 and 5, a grinding and polishing machine auxiliary device includes: burnishing machine 1 and layer board 3, be equipped with polishing dish 2 in the burnishing machine 1, 2 tops of polishing dish are equipped with a plurality of anchor clamps 11, all are equipped with in anchor clamps 11 and grind appearance 12, and anchor clamps 11 all connect the guide arm outward and fix around connecting rod 9, can once grind a plurality of grinding appearance 12.
The supporting plate 3 is connected with a support, the support can stretch out and draw back along the vertical direction, the height of the support can be changed, and the polishing machine is suitable for polishing machines with different heights. The support includes lower carriage 4, lower carriage 4 connects layer board 3, installs upper bracket 5 that can follow vertical direction and remove in the lower carriage 4, installs fixed establishment 6 on the upper and lower support, and fixed establishment 6 is used for giving 5 spacing fixes of upper bracket, and upper bracket 5 joint support pole 7. The fixing mechanism 6 comprises an annular bolt 61, the annular bolt 61 is installed at the upper end of the lower support, a cam 62 is hinged on the annular bolt 61, a shifting lever is connected onto the cam 62, the upper support 5 is provided with a long groove 64, a pressing block 63 is arranged in the long groove 64, the upper end and the lower end of the pressing block 63 penetrate through the inner side of the annular bolt 61, and the shifting lever is rotated to enable the cam 62 to rotate to press or release the pressing block 63 so as to press or release the upper support 5. The cam 62 can be rotated by rotating the deflector rod, the pressing block 63 is loosened by the cam 62, the upper bracket 5 is pulled, the upper bracket 5 moves relative to the pressing block 63 to change the height of the bracket, the polishing machine is suitable for polishing machines with different heights, the cam 62 is rotated reversely, the pressing block 63 is pressed by the cam 62, the pressing block 63 is pressed on the upper bracket 5, and the height of the bracket can be fixed.
The supporting rod 7 can stretch out and draw back along the transverse direction, the length of the supporting rod can be adjusted, and the polishing machine is suitable for polishing machines with different lengths. The support rod 7 comprises a right support rod 71, the right support rod 71 is connected with the upper end of the support, the right support rod 71 is vertically connected with the support, a left support rod 72 is arranged in the right support rod 71, a moving mechanism is arranged on the rear side of the right support rod 71 to drive the left support rod 72 to move transversely, and the left support rod 72 is connected with the support sleeve 8. The moving mechanism comprises a mounting seat 73, the mounting seat 73 is fixed on the rear side of the right supporting rod 71, a gear 75 is arranged in the mounting seat 73, a rack is arranged on the rear side of the left supporting rod 72 and meshed with the gear 75, the gear 75 is driven to rotate through a driving piece to enable the left supporting rod 72 to move transversely, the supporting sleeve 8 is driven to move to enable the supporting sleeve 8 to be sleeved outside the connecting rod 9, and the connecting rod 9 is fixed through a locking screw 10.
The fixture comprises a fixture 110, a sleeve 111 penetrates through the fixture 110, a handle is connected to the sleeve 111 and located outside the fixture 110, threads are arranged in the sleeve 111 and matched with a lead screw 114, two ends of the lead screw 114 extend out of the sleeve 111, a top plate 115 is installed at one end of the lead screw 114, a groove 112 is formed in the sleeve 111, a fastener 113 penetrates through the fixture 110 and is clamped in the groove 112, the groove 112 is 7-shaped and is divided into a transverse groove and a vertical groove, the transverse groove is vertically connected with the vertical groove, the groove 112 is matched with the fastener 113, and the sleeve 111 can be rotated to enable the sleeve 111 to move or limit. The handle is rotated, the sleeve 111 rotates, the fastener 113 moves into the transverse groove from the vertical groove, the sleeve 111 can be moved left and right, when the sleeve 111 is moved to a proper position, the sleeve 111 rotates reversely, the fastener 113 moves into the vertical groove, the sleeve 111 is limited left and right, the screw 114 is rotated, and the screw moves to enable the top plate 115 to press the grinding sample piece 12.
When the polishing machine is used, a plurality of clamps 11 on the connecting rod are placed on the polishing disk 2, the driving piece drives the gear 75 to rotate, the rack moves to drive the left supporting rod 72 to move, the upper bracket 5 is pulled, the height of the bracket is adjusted, the supporting sleeve 8 is sleeved on the connecting rod 9 and is fixed through the locking screw 10, the cam 62 is rotated, the cam 62 presses the pressing block 63, the pressing block 63 is pressed on the upper bracket 5, and the height of the bracket can be fixed. The grinding sample 12 is placed in the clamp 11, the handle is rotated, the sleeve 111 rotates, the fastener 113 moves into the transverse groove from the vertical groove, the sleeve 111 can be moved left and right, when the sleeve is moved to a proper position, the sleeve 111 rotates reversely, the fastener 113 moves into the vertical groove, the sleeve 111 is limited left and right, the screw 114 is rotated, and the screw 114 moves to enable the top plate 115 to press the grinding sample 12. The polishing disk rotates to polish the sample 12, and when the polishing is completed, the screw 114 is rotated in the opposite direction, so that the top plate 115 releases the sample 12.
